Description
Job Description:Leidos has an opportunity for a Security Engineer at Lackland AFB in San Antonio, TX. Candidates must already possess a current TS/SCI security clearance.The Security Engineer for this effort is responsible for: 1) Providing technical direction for Air Force customers migrating to Commercial Cloud Services (C2S); 2) playing a key role in integrating all cloud solutions and strategies into the Risk Management Framework and overall business practices; 3) possessing the technical understanding to provide expert guidance about AWS, IC ITE GovCloud, IC ITE C2S, and other federal government community or emerging cloud frameworks; 4) Communicate with Air Force Commercial Cloud Services (AFC2S) team members, delegated authorizing officials and other government security representatives; 5) adherence to all aspects of the Information Assurance (IA) program; 6) preparation of Assessment and Authorization (A&A) documents and procedures throughout the entire systems development life cycle.
